LMC Healthcare (LMC) is Canada\xe2\x80\x99s largest specialist care provider in diabetes & endocrinology. We\xe2\x80\x99re transforming diabetes care by making it more accessible, comprehensive, and patient-centric than ever before. LMC has 13 multi-disciplinary centers of excellence and 22 clinical research sites located in 3 provinces (Ontario, Alberta, and Quebec). Our 60+ Endocrinologists, many of whom are nationally renowned for their areas of expertise, are supported by an interdisciplinary team of highly qualified Medical Office Administrators, Medical Assistants, Registered Nurses, Registered Dietitians, Physician Assistants, Pharmacists, Optometrists, Opticians, Optical Assistants, Chiropodists and Clinical Research Professionals.

Currently, our growing team is looking for an Optometric Assistant who can work with us on a permanent part-time basis at our LMC Scarborough location. This position requires 2 days of in clinic work and 1 flexible day where work can be performed remotely.

Responsibilities:

  • Greeting patients in person, by telephone, or online
  • Booking/Scheduling appointments
  • Marking recalls and cold calls to book appointments
  • Pretesting patients and other auxiliary tests
  • Explain procedures and costs to patients
  • Check in and check out patients in clinic
  • Facilitate patient referrals to other health care professionals
  • Assisting in ordering of contact lenses
  • Ensuring the office is billed properly for orders and proper credits are issued
